A word invented by my son when he was two.
As far as I could tell, it's an all-purpose unit of measurement.
It can be used to describe length, mass, time, or any combination thereof.

Even more usefully, it seems that the actual size of a mundit is equal to
the size of the thing you're describing divided by the number of mundits you say it is.

Hence, my son could jump on the bathroom scales and proclaim "52 mundits!"
in the self-assured voice of someone who already has the answer.
